Final answer:

Elizabeth I reigned as Queen of England from 1558 to 1603. The correct option is a.

Step-by-step explanation:

The Queen of England who reigned from 1558 to 1603 was Elizabeth I. She was the youngest daughter of Henry VIII and continued the Tudor dynasty when she came to the throne. Elizabeth I reflected the religious diversity of the time and her policies leaned towards Protestantism.
